建站必备技术 5大核心技能快速上手

建站必备技术 5大核心技能快速上手

访客 2026-04-01 网站设计 2 次浏览 0个评论

做网站需要哪些技术?全面解析建站必备技能

建站必备技术 5大核心技能快速上手

在数字化时代,拥有一个专业网站已成为企业和个人展示形象的重要途径。无论是搭建企业官网、电商平台还是个人博客,掌握做网站需要的核心技术至关重要。本文将系统介绍从前端开发到后端运维的全套技术栈,帮助初学者快速入门,并为有经验的开发者提供技术选型参考。

前端开发:构建用户界面

前端技术是网站的门面,直接影响用户体验。HTML5和CSS3是构建网页结构的基石,负责内容呈现和样式设计。JavaScript及其流行框架(如React、Vue或Angular)则实现交互功能。响应式设计技术确保网站在不同设备上完美显示,而Webpack等打包工具能优化前端资源加载速度。对于追求视觉效果的项目,还需要掌握Canvas、SVG等图形技术。

后端开发:网站的核心引擎

后端技术处理网站的业务逻辑和数据存储。主流编程语言包括PHP(配合Laravel框架)、Python(Django/Flask)、Java(Spring Boot)和Node.js等。数据库技术分为关系型(MySQL、PostgreSQL)和非关系型(MongoDB),根据数据特点选择。API开发(RESTful或GraphQL)实现前后端分离,而缓存技术(Redis)和消息队列(RabbitMQ)能显著提升性能。安全性方面需掌握防SQL注入、XSS攻击等防护措施。

服务器与部署:网站的运维基础

网站上线需要服务器技术支持。云服务(AWS、阿里云)提供弹性资源,Nginx/Apache负责请求转发和负载均衡。Docker容器化技术简化环境部署,CI/CD流水线(如Jenkins)实现自动化测试和发布。掌握Linux系统基础命令和Shell脚本是运维必备技能。对于高流量网站,还需了解CDN加速、分布式架构等进阶方案。

SEO与性能优化:提升网站价值

技术实现只是基础,让网站产生价值需要SEO优化技术。包括合理设置meta标签、优化URL结构、提升页面加载速度(Lighthouse工具分析)。结构化数据标记帮助搜索引擎理解内容,而移动优先索引要求做好移动端适配。持续监控(Google Analytics)和A/B测试能不断优化转化率。

做网站需要的技术涵盖前端展示、后端逻辑、服务器运维和SEO优化等多个维度。随着技术进步,WebAssembly、PWA等新技术不断涌现,开发者需要保持学习。建议初学者从HTML/CSS/JavaScript基础开始,逐步扩展技术栈。记住,技术是手段而非目的,始终以解决用户需求为核心才能打造成功的网站。

转载请注明来自孟涛号,本文标题:《建站必备技术 5大核心技能快速上手》

每一天,每一秒,你所做的决定都会改变你的人生!

发表评论

快捷回复:

评论列表 (暂无评论,2人围观)参与讨论

还没有评论,来说两句吧...